Doorstep Sale of Variable Priced Goods Terms of Business
BS.DSS.06D
These Doorstep Sale of Variable Priced Goods Terms of Business are intended
to be used by traders who sell products on a door-to-door basis rather than
via retail premises or the internet.
Sellers should use this set of terms where the goods sold include goods
whose price may vary according to fluctuations in financial markets. The
“cooling-off” period and right to cancel mentioned below, which generally
apply to doorstep sales contracts, do not apply in relation to “variable
priced” goods.
If the transaction involves goods which are consumable, perishable or
intended to be fitted into the customer’s home, please select one of our
alternative sets of Terms of Business.

The template also complies with the Consumer Contracts (Information,
Cancellation and Additional Charges) Regulations 2013, which came into
force on 13th June 2014. In particular:
- Customers entering into contracts “off the premises” of the seller are
given a cooling-off period. The cooling-off period starts when the contract
is made and ends 14 days after the goods come into the physical possession
of the customer. This means the customer can change their mind for any
reason and return the goods to the seller.
- The customer is given a clear and concise summary of the pre-contract
information they are entitled to receive.
